Overview

Postcode TR18 3EN is located in an urban city, within the Ludgvan, Madron, Gulval & Heamoor ward of Cornwall in the South West region, and forms part of the Penzance North area. It has moderate deprivation and moderate crime levels, with around 48.4 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income per household in Penzance North is £39,788 per year. The nearest station is Penzance located about 1.0 miles away. There are 5 primary and 2 secondary schools in the area. There are 1 parks nearby, closest small park is Heamoor Old School Field.

Property prices in Ludgvan, Madron, Gulval & Heamoor

Based on 67 recent sales, the median property price is £275,000 in Ludgvan, Madron, Gulval & Heamoor area, with individual transactions ranging from £42,000 up to £790,000.
